Valve has begun to kick players out of the beta version of Counter-Strike 2
Valve has started to exclude players from the beta version of Counter-Strike 2, an updated version of CS:GO on the Source 2 engine, which is expected to be released in the summer. Currently, Valve is conducting limited beta testing, but some participants have already lost access to it.

Players report an error when trying to start matchmaking, after which they are prompted to leave the beta version and restart the game. Valve has not yet announced the end of testing. Recently, beta testers have complained about long queues, which sometimes reached 40 minutes. It should be reminded that the transition to Counter-Strike 2 will be presented in the form of a free update for all users.
